Windload in probabilistic reliability assessment method
Hanzlík, P. ; Marek, Pavel
The development of new approaches to structural reliability assessment leads to introduction of probabilistic methods. Application of these methods requires a new representation of loads and all other input quantities by non-parametric distributions as well as a non-traditional approach to the evaluation of reliability expressed by comparison of probability of failure and the target probability. The aim of this paper is to indicate a probabilistic approach to the reliability assessment of a structure exposed to combination of wind load (expressed by two-component wind rosette) and several other loads (expressed by single-component load duration curves).
